Warming and Powering UpIf your laptop is cold from being outside, or if you are simply transferring your laptop to a significantly warmer area, do not turn it on or open the screen until it has had time to acclimate. Let your laptop sit for at least fifteen minutes while it warms up to your current environment.

Use iOS and iPadOS devices where the ambient temperature is between 0º and 35º C (32º to 95º F). Low- or high-temperature conditions might cause your device to change its behavior to regulate its temperature. Using an iOS or iPadOS device in very hot conditions can permanently shorten battery life.How cold is too cold to store electronics?

Most computers get warm after a while, and some can get quite hot. This is normal: it is simply part of the way that the computer cools itself. However, if your computer gets very warm it could be a sign that it is overheating, which can potentially cause damage.Is it OK for my PC to be a little hot?
Anything under 60 degrees C (140 degrees F) is perfect. Just above this temperature is okay, but as you creep above 70 degrees C (158 degrees F), you should look at how to cool your PC down. Above 81 degrees C (178 degrees F) is too hot and could cause damage to your computer if you run it for a sustained period.Does a colder PC run faster?

Cool temperatures allow a CPU to run faster because there is less ambient heat, which increases the efficiency of whatever cooling system it uses. Since there is less heat, the CPU can clock itself higher before thermally throttling.Can a GPU get too cold?
It really depends on the computer and whether you are prepared for the temperatures involved. Quite a few CPUs, motherboards and GPUs have what is called a “cold bug” where they will not start up if the temperature below a certain value.What happens if your device is too cold?
